Analysis

The most recent figure for benefits incidence in extreme poor (<$2.15 a day) (%) - all social in Brazil is 26.4%, measured in 2022.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 11.5% on the previous year and up 29.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, benefits incidence in extreme poor (<$2.15 a day) (%) - all social in Brazil peaked at 31.3% in 2015 and was at its lowest, 18.5%, in 2011.

That places Brazil 8th out of 35 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.

Benefits incidence in extreme poor (<$2.15 a day) (%) - All Social in Brazil, year by year

Annual values for Benefits incidence in extreme poor (<$2.15 a day) (%) - All Social Assistance (preT) in Brazil, 2009 to 2022.
Year preT Change
2009 22.0%
2011 18.5% -16.0%
2012 20.4% +10.2%
2015 31.3% +53.7%
2016 27.8% -11.1%
2017 29.3% +5.3%
2018 30.1% +2.9%
2019 28.1% -6.7%
2020 21.8% -22.6%
2021 23.7% +8.9%
2022 26.4% +11.5%

Brazil compared with similar countries

  • Brazil's 26.4% is above the median for upper middle income countries, which is 12.4%, 2.1× the median. (23 countries reporting)
  • Brazil's 26.4% is above the median for Latin America & Caribbean, which is 7.9%, 3.3× the median. (15 countries reporting)
